    Abstract: A method is disclosed to suppress coherent noise in seismic data. Based on the Karhunen-Loeve Transform, this method trains on a region containing undesired coherent noise. Eigenvectors determined from the convariance matrix of that noise are used to reconstruct the noise throughout the data set. Subtracting the reconstruction from the original data leaves a residual in which the coherent noise has been suppressed. Applying this method to a shot record of marine seismic data illustrates that the procedure does suppress noise on actual seismic data.

    Abstract: A vibration dampening assembly, such as a dynamic balancing apparatus, is connected to a drill bit, a downhole motor or drillstring to exert a variable force to counteract vibration inducing forces. The dynamic balancing apparatus includes a support body which supports a plurality of freely movable masses so that the masses move to a position for opposing an imbalance force which rotates with, and at the same speed as, the drill bit, downhole motor or drillstring.

    Abstract: To divert sufficient fluid flow through an unsealed bearing section of a downhole drilling motor, a flow control apparatus is provided for insertion between the power section of the motor and the bottom of a drill bit which is to be turned by the motor. The flow control apparatus includes a variable flow channel having a selectable effective cross-sectional area preferably embodied by a valve. A selected effective cross-sectional area is chosen by a control mechanism, such as a snap ring or a spring used to control the position of a valve member of the valve in response to different flow rates of fluid pumped through the valve depending upon whether the drill bit is on-bottom or off-bottom. In one embodiment the apparatus is incorporated within the interior of a drill bit which has angled flow channels to direct flushing fluid flow to side wall locations where reaming occurs. Flow through these outlets is controlled by positioning of the valve member.

    Abstract: The orientation of a downhole steering assembly used in drilling a horizontal well is located with respect to the earth using a sub placed above the downhole assembly. The sub comprises a housing having a central bore defining an inlet flow passageway said housing further defining a toroidal chamber in communication with said passageway. The toroidal chamber has a pocket, a valve seat, and a spherical valve that is rotatable in said toroidal chamber from a normally seated position in the pocket. Upon rotation of the drill string the spherical valve plugs the valve seat and causes an increase in the resistance to flow in the drilling mud through the drill string that can be detected at the surface.

    Abstract: A drill bit includes a drill bit body, a cutting member and a fluid course extending in front of the cutting member. The fluid course includes a progressively widening diffuser having a particular design which allows pressure recovery in a fluid flowed through an axial bore of the drill bit body, through a narrow throat of the fluid course in front of the cutting member, and out the progressively widening diffuser of the fluid course. As a result, a significantly reduced pressure is obtained in front of the cutting member, which reduced pressure is below a borehole pressure where the drill bit is used.

    Abstract: To stabilize a drill string and to reduce or prevent wellbore deviation in directional drilling, weight rods by which weight is to be applied to drill bit are maintained free-standing and under compression within a drill string while the drill string itself is maintained in tension to limit or prevent lateral deviation of the weight rods in compression. Weight provided by the weight rods is transferred to the drill bit through a load transfer member in compression connected between the drill string and the drill bit.

    Abstract: Disclosed is a concurrency control method and related system for permitting the correct execution of multiple concurrent transactions, each comprising one or more read and/or write operations, in a heterogeneous distributed database system. Read and write operations are processed at the required sites if no site cycles are detected. If any site cycles are detected in a read operation, then new sites are searched for. If any site cycle is detected for any of the sites for a write operation, then the transaction is aborted.

    Abstract: A method and related apparatus are disclosed herein for controlling the quantity of oil as a contaminant being discharged with water from a hydrocyclone. The hydrocyclone comprises a conical body with an upper liquid mixture inlet, a drive fluid inlet, an overflow outlet for the separated oil and drive fluid, and an underflow outlet for the separated water. The method includes monitoring the quantity of separated oil with the discharged water and varying the quantity of the drive fluid introduced into the interior of the hydrocyclone whereby the quantity of the oil as a contaminant is minimized.

    Abstract: A method as disclosed of assisting in the determination of the existence of conical folding of the geological formation utilizing an existing dipmeter survey obtained through a wellbore penetrating the geological formation. Estimates of plunge and aperture of the geological formation, as well as the position of the wellbore with respect to the geologic formation are made. These estimates are utilized to generate a synthetic dip plot representative of conical folding. The synthetic dip plot is compared to the existing dipmeter survey, and one or more of the estimates are varied to obtain a final synthetic dip plot that has the highest correlation of the dipmeter survey, thereby providing an assistance in the determination of existence of conical folding of the geological formation.

    Abstract: An excavating system, such as for drilling an oil or gas well, includes a source of high pressure fluid and a drillstring through which the fluid is conducted to an excavating apparatus connected to the bottom of the drillstring. The excavating apparatus includes a drill bit having mechanical cutting elements for mechanically boring into an earthen formation. The excavating apparatus also includes a nozzle rotatably mounted to the body of the drill bit so that the nozzle is rotatable about an axis of rotation different from the axis of rotation of the drill bit. As the drill bit is rotated about its axis of rotation, high pressure fluid is ejected from the nozzle to rotate the nozzle about its axis of rotation while the nozzle orbits the axis of rotation of the drill bit.

    Abstract: A liquid separator is disclosed for separating a liquid mixture into first and second liquids of different densities. The liquid separator includes a substantially conical chamber having a closed upper portion with a liquid mixture inlet therein. A first liquid collecting mechanism is provided in a lower portion of the conical chamber for collecting and removing a first separated liquid, and a second liquid collecting device surrounds the opening in the lower portion of the conical chamber for collecting and removing a second separated liquid. A return conduit mechanism is provided for returning a portion of the second separated liquid tangentially into an upper portion of the conical chamber to act as a drive fluid to cause the centrally introduced liquid mixture to rotate for effective and efficient separation.

    Abstract: A system for directional drilling and related method of use is described herein which utilizes a drillstring suspended within a wellbore with an MWD and downhole turbine or motor connected adjacent a drill bit on a lower end of the drillstring, and with a top drive and/or rotary table connected adjacent an upper end of the drillstring. Within the method, desired limits of drilling associated parameters are inputted into a memory associated with a programmable digital computer. While drilling the wellbore, transmitted values of the drilling associated parameters are inputted into the memory. If the transmitted values are outsude of the desired limits, necessary adjustments are calculated and then made to weight-on-bit (WOB), RPM and/or drillstring azimuthal orientation to bring the transmitted values within the desired limits.

    Abstract: A method and related system are disclosed for controlling the operation of a fixed rate pumped hydrocyclone liquid separation unit to maintain a desired back-pressure therein. A pressure control valve and a liquid level control valve are connected to a separated liquid discharge conduit extending from at least one hydrocyclone. The pressure control valve operates in response to the pressure of the liquid introduced into the hydrocyclone and the liquid level control valve operates in response to the liquid level within a liquid holding vessel that supplies the liquid through a fixed rate pump to the hydrocyclone.

    Abstract: A method and apparatus for indicating the position of a cement wiper plug in a wellbore during liner or casing cementing operations. The arrival of the cement wiper plug at a shearable, temporary restriction means in a pipe string is sensed by an increase in pipe string pressure at the surface. Using the knowledge of the location of this shearable, temporary restriction means, a determination of whether or not it is desirable to displace the cement wiper plug to a landing assembly at the bottom of the pipe string can be made. A predetermined amount of displacing fluid, sufficient to either completely or partially displace the cement wiper plug to the landing assembly, can then be introduced into the pipe string.
